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
696 34043988 48
59313850 11
59313850 11
159864039 780948 014 686
All about undefined
Interested in learning more?
59313850 11
159864039 780948 014 686
See more
6035583 125657100 64131
75096 848 36
See more
17326745 6372205 8837
46 52041959 014976397
See more